The Kurar police have arrested a man for allegedly trying to kill his 13-year-old daughter and staging the death of his eight-year-old son in an attempt to get his wife to return from her native village.


Police said the accused, Ajay Gaud, 35, lives at Kurar Village, Malad. His brother (the complainant) Suchit Gaud told the police that Ajay is an alcoholic who used to assault his wife and kids.



Fed up of this, two years ago, Ajay’s wife left him and went to her native village and never returned. On Sunday, Gaud called his wife and told her that their son had died and daughter had committed suicide and sent a picture of a body covered with a white bed sheet.

He then made his daughter climb on a bucket and put a noose, hanging from the ceiling fan, around her neck, said an officer. When he was forcibly trying to do so, the girl screamed saying she did not want to die. Hearing this, the neighbours gathered outside the house and broke open the door thinking the girl was being murdered.

The neighbours informed Suchit Gaud, who later contacted the Kurar police.

“We have arrested Gaud on charges of attempt to murder, assault and threatening of the Indian Penal Code,” said Prakash Bele, senior police inspector of Kurar police station.
